Abstract

The invention discloses a kind of sewage-treatment plants,Including treatment tank,Automatic medicine adding apparatus is housed on treatment tank,Treatment tank connects grille well by the first waste pipe,Grid bottom is sequentially arranged with DO detectors and PH detectors,Grille well is connected with sedimentation basin by the second waste pipe,Sedimentation basin connects regulating reservoir by third waste pipe,Regulating reservoir is connected with hydrolysis acidification pool,One end of hydrolysis acidification pool is connected with activated sludge tank by the 4th waste pipe,Hydrolysis acidification pool connects sludge reservoir by the first sludge pipe,Sludge reservoir is connected with belt type dehydration computer room by the second sludge pipe,Activated sludge tank is connected to by third sludge pipe on the first sludge pipe,The activated sludge tank other end is connected with the 5th waste pipe,5th waste pipe one end is connected with secondary settling tank,Upside is equipped with ultraviolet ray disinfector in the secondary settling tank,The secondary settling tank is connected with clear water reserviors by the 6th waste pipe.

- 3 are please referred to Fig.1, the present invention provides a kind of technical solution:Including treatment tank(1, it is equipped on treatment tank Automatic medicine adding apparatus 2, treatment tank 1 connect grille well 4 by the first waste pipe 3, and 4 bottom of grille well is sequentially arranged with DO detections Instrument 5 and PH detectors 6, grille well 4 are connected with sedimentation basin 7 by the second waste pipe 8, and sedimentation basin 7 is connected by third waste pipe 9 Regulating reservoir 10 is connect, regulating reservoir 10 is connected with hydrolysis acidification pool 11 by the 7th waste pipe 40, the other end of hydrolysis acidification pool 11 It is connected with activated sludge tank 13 by the 4th waste pipe 12, hydrolysis acidification pool 11 connects sludge reservoir by the first sludge pipe 14 15, sludge reservoir 15 is connected with belt type dehydration computer room 16 by the second sludge pipe 17, and activated sludge tank 13 passes through third sludge Pipe 18 is connected on the first sludge pipe 14, and 13 other end of activated sludge tank is connected with the 5th waste pipe 19, the 5th waste pipe 19 other ends are connected with secondary settling tank 20, and upside is equipped with ultraviolet ray disinfector 21 in secondary settling tank 20, and secondary settling tank 20 is logical with clear water reserviors 22 The 6th waste pipe 23 is crossed to be connected.
In the present invention, automatic medicine adding apparatus 2 includes spray tank 25, and spray tank 25 is equipped with metering pump 26, on metering pump 26 It is separately connected pipeline 27 and switch board 28, the pipeline 27 connects counterbalance valve 29, and 29 other end of counterbalance valve connects dosing pipe 30, Dosing pipe 30 is equipped with introduction valve 31, and blender 32 is connected on switch board 28.
In the present invention, activated sludge tank 13 passes through anti-return Guan Lian by anaerobic pond 35, anoxic pond 36 and oxidation ditch 37 respectively Composition is connect, the inner dispensing of secondary settling tank 20 has flocculant, and 20 inner wall of the second waste pipe between secondary settling tank 14 and clear water reserviors 16 was equipped with Strainer, the model BPH-220 of model DO-6800-YG, the PH detector 5 of DO detectors 4, the other end of clear water reserviors 16 are The material of effluent outfall 24, drainage pipeline is UPVC.
Operation principle:Water enters in treatment tank, and automatic medicine adding apparatus is launched liquid and is stirred inside, to water Matter is handled, and then big contaminant filter is fallen by grille well, and the DO detectors and PH detectors of grid bottom are to water In dissolved oxygen and PH be detected, if water quality reaching standard, water is introduced into sedimentation basin by waste pipe and is allowed to settle one section Time makes impurities sink down, feeds the water into regulating reservoir regulating water quality later, has adjusted water quality and water is sent to water by conduit later It solves in acidification pool, it, will be miscellaneous after having decomposed at substances such as methane and carbon dioxides by various complexity organic matter decomposition and inversions in waste water Matter is sent to sludge reservoir, and water is flowed into activated sludge tank, and water is sent to belt type dehydration computer room after being detached in sludge reservoir It is dehydrated, is then transported impurity, water makes activated sludge be in suspended state in activated sludge tank, has to the solubility in water Machine object adsorbed, is absorbed and oxygenolysis, and water is poured into secondary settling tank later and carries out mud-water separation, is also concentrated to sludge, Ultraviolet light is flowed into after being sterilized to it in clear water reserviors, and water is discharged.
